Workshop to discuss a crisis scenario
Background
A global pharmaceutical company hired the 3-core to conduct a crisis management exercise on cyber-attacks to review the company’s existing processes, identify weaknesses, prepare employees for real crisis situations and increase the efficiency of cooperation in Crisis.
Solution
The customer provided all relevant documents required for the preparation of the exercise. Coordination meetings took place to ensure that the exercise was well prepared and met the requirements of all the stakeholders. These preparations resulted in a four-hour workshop.
The workshop started with a welcome and introduction to familiarise participants with the process and provide an overview of the topic and objectives of the workshop. Subsequently, the most important tools and strategies for crisis management were presented and explained. After the theoretical part, an active exercise took place in which a crisis was simulated and discussed. The exercise was then reviewed and discussed. At the end of the workshop all important results were summarised.
Finally, a report was prepared and presented to the customer. The report is used to document the results of the exercise, record key findings and formulate suggestions for improvement. This follow-up provides the customer with a clear overview of the strengths and weaknesses of their processes as well as recommendations for action to optimise their crisis management processes.
